To get thick eyebrows natural shape, the following guidelines for you, as quoted by Ourvanity

1. Carefully cut
To get the perfect eyebrow, let your eyebrow hair grows naturally. If you grow eyebrow hair starts to look “messy”, simply trim the eyebrow hairs using tweezers or a tweezer. However, the difficulty straightening your eyebrows can do in a professional salon.

2. Serum hair grower
Eyebrow hair can be grown with hair serum. This fluid is believed to work effectively to grow eyebrows faster. In addition, thin eyebrows can be thickened with a hair tonic.

3. Grow your brow with olive oil
Natural way to grow the eyebrows is the olive oil. Apply before bed. Content in olive oil are believed to grow and thicken hair.

4. Use an eyebrow pencil
If you are thin eyebrows, try a brown eyebrow pencil or dark gray for a natural impression. You want to get a natural thick eyebrows like yours Kim Kadarshian, try to comb brows upwards and sideways as the growth of eyebrows and apply eyebrow pencil or eyeshadow on some empty space. Do not forget to dab highlighter under the brow to emphasize the tail shape.

Meanwhile, thick eyebrows can also look elegant with the right makeup. Camilla Belle is often seen combined with the thick eyebrows red lipstick and eye makeup is simple. As for the thick eyebrows and makeup smokey eyes should be paired with a soft pink shade of lipstick or a nude like Carine Roitfeld.
